Hi there Luis. I've recently had to update a project to a newer version of Unity because I wasn't able to get the parallax extension working. The parallax layers would not show up at all during runtime. after some digging I saw that this was a bug with the older versions, and I've also recently seen your comments on others posts about similar issues. After updating to Unity 2022.2.21f1 I'm able to get the parallax effect working on my layers however, my global light does not affect them and so all sprites are showing up black. I've tried changing the sorting layers, for the light culling, but nothing seems to be working. Do you have an idea where I could be going wrong? It's getting to the point that I'm spending more time trying to fix this issue than I am actually working on my game, and I would really like to be able to take advantage of this asset, as I don't want to feel like I wasted money on an asset that I can't even use. any help would be much appreciated! Jesse EDIT: So after some more tinkering, I figured out that by changing the global light to its own layer and including said layer in the parallax extension the background sprites are actually affected by the light now. (See photo for example) So if anyone has the same problem I did, remember to include the global light in the parallax layers and it should all be working fine!
